Description

Draws a ramp joining three points, definedinteractively bya start, end and intermediate point.

How to Use

  1. Run the command.

  2. In the Snapping toolbar, select the required snap and data selection settings.

  3. In the Current Objects toolbar, select the current object or create a new one. More...

  4. In the Current Objects toolbar, select the required Attribute Field and associated Attribute Value parameters. More....

  5. Click to define the start point of the ramp.

  6. Click to define the end point of the ramp.

  7. Click to define the intermediate point of the ramp.

  8. If required, click or click-and-drag to move the intermediate point.

  9. Click Cancel to complete the creation of the ramp string.

  • If no strings object exists in memory, a new object will be created when this command is run, displaying details of the new object immediately in the Current Objects toolbar.
  • Right-click for snap; left-click for placing points without snapping.
  • If snapping is toggled on, points may be snapped using the right mouse button.
  • Iif you are using a 3-button mouse, the middle button (or the button that emulates this function) will not perform any function in relation to this command.
  • The status bar gives the radius and view gradient of the ramp as you drag the circle.
